Why should the Timberwolves be your NBA Pick?
The Timberwolves have quietly crept their way into the #6 spot in the Western Conference with a 14-11 record, but their recent play suggests that they may have a difficult time holding of the teams sitting just behind them right now. The Timberwolves are just 4-6 in their last 10 games and have struggled to find any level of consistency, as they do not have any back to back wins during that 10-game run. A big part of their problem has been an inability to get the job done on the road, where they are currently at 6-7 on the season. That said, where they have been strong this year is in games against conference foes, as they have amassed an 11-5 record, which includes their 112-106 win over these Clippers a couple of nights ago. Why should the Clippers be your NBA Pick?
The LA Clippers are starting to see a trend develop when they play the Minnesota Timberwolves, as their loss to them the other night now means that they have lost 3 in a row to the T-Wolves. Of greater concern, though, is the 9-14 start that the Clippers have made to the season, which now includes 3-straight losses coming into this one. The Staples center has not been the happy home that it used to be for the Clippers, as they are a couple of games below .500 in their own building.
